Xtream Codes API vs M3U Playlist

When configuring an IPTV player app, you will typically choose between two login formats:

  • Xtream Codes API (Recommended): Requires 3 pieces of information: Server URL (e.g. `http://line.cibortv.shop:8080`), Username, and Password. Xtream API loads channel logos, EPG data, and VOD categories faster than M3U links.
  • M3U Link: A single long URL containing your encrypted credentials. Ideal for apps like VLC Player, SS IPTV, or GSE Smart IPTV.

What is an EPG (Electronic Program Guide)?

An EPG (Electronic Program Guide) is an interactive onscreen grid that displays past, present, and upcoming television program schedules. It provides show titles, plot summaries, air times, and episode metadata for all 41,821+ cibortv channels.
